Methods for Competitive Play

To truly dominate in competitive gaming, you need to understand the meta. This means staying ahead on the newest trends, popular strategies, and enemy team compositions. Constantly analyze matches, deconstruct your own gameplay, and adapt your approach to thwart your opponents' moves. Don't just learn strategies; truly grasp them to make quick decisions and exploit opportunities as they arise.

  • Analyze top players and their strategies.
  • Experiment different builds, hero combinations, and playstyles to locate what works best for you.
  • Coordinate effectively with your team, sharing information and planning coordinated attacks.

Gaming Beyond Screens: Immersive Experiences

The horizon of gaming is rapidly expanding, moving beyond the confines of traditional screens and into realms of immersion. Gamers are craving experiences that engage them, blurring the lines between the virtual and real. This shift is driven by groundbreaking innovations such as augmented reality (AR), virtual reality (VR), and mixed reality (MR). These systems offer players unprecedented levels of physical engagement, allowing them to step inside game worlds in entirely new ways.

  • AR overlays digital elements onto the real world, creating interactive layers that blend seamlessly with our surroundings.
  • VR submerges players in fully simulated environments, providing a sense of presence and allowing them to influence their virtual surroundings.
  • MR blends the real and virtual worlds, offering a dynamic and interactive experience where digital objects can coexist with physical ones.

Consequently, gaming is evolving into a multi-sensory and participatory art form. From participatory storytelling to collaborative gameplay, these technologies are transforming the very nature of how we experience games.
